    As you can see above I love to add QR codes to my pages. I either use Liz's templates or I just add a square somewhere slightly bigger that my QR code just to set it off. I often will add an arrow pointing to it too, just to draw attention to it. :)

    I kept thinking ... I gotta do something with those codes that don't stick out like a sore thumb! Then I saw those tags in Lynn's kit. I extracted the black part and put it on the tag. I think I've found a new way to use those silly codes!
